    Islamization of West-African radicalism. Research among the youths in the Grand Yoff neighbourhood in Dakar, Senegal

    Get PDF
    In order to determine the radicalization level of the Muslim society in West Africa and in order to understand the influence coming over radicalized Africans from Islam fundamentalism exporting countries, we conducted a sociologic survey on a target group consisting of 107 Muslim men, aged between 18 and 45, from the popular neighbourhood Grand Yoff in Dakar, Senegal. We surveyed their religiousness and radicalization in correlation with their attitude towards the West and their behaviour in front of various daily life situations. That is because in one of the poorest regions in the world, political claims mix with the social ones and lead to the emergence of social radicalism, on which the Islam overlaps perfectly

    Cities for people or the reason for social radicalization? Dakar’s special case

    Get PDF
    In West Africa, in particular Dakar, Senegal, due to the lack of coherent programs of control of chaotic urbanization, in the popular neighborhoods without any kind of infrastructure, a series of profound crises emerged in the last 15-20 years have led to an unprecedented increase in the differences between urban development levels and, implicitly, social segregation and radicalism. The issue of housing has a major impact on the welfare of the citizen, especially from a social point of view. The home is a private space necessary for personal security and isolation from the world, a space of relaxation and everyday life, one that should provide the necessary comfort for every individual

    New particle-hole symmetries and the extended interacting boson model

    Get PDF
    We describe shape coexistence and intruder many-particle-hole (mp-nh)excitations in the extended interacting boson model EIBM and EIBM-2,combining both the particle-hole and the charge degree of freedom.Besides the concept of I-spin multiplets and subsequently SU(4)SU(4) multiplets, we touch upon the existence of particle-hole mixed symmetry states. We furthermore describe regular and intrudermany-particle-hole excitations in one nucleus on an equal footing, creating (annihilating) particle-hole pairs using the K-spin operatorand studying possible mixing between these states. As a limiting case,we treat the coupling of two IBM-1 Hamiltonians, each decribing the regular and intruder excitations respectively, in particular lookingat the U(5)U(5)-SU(3)SU(3) dynamical symmetry coupling. We apply such coupling scheme to the Po isotopes

    Shape coexistence in atomic nuclei and its spectroscopic fingerprints

    Get PDF
    In the present discussion we concentrate on shape coexistence asobtained within a deformed single-particle field as well as startingfrom the spherical shell-model, incorporating deformationeffects via the residual proton-neutron quadrupole interaction. Wediscuss in particular the appearance of shape coexisting phenomena inthe Pb region. In a second part then, we present a number ofexperimental fingerprints that allow to recognize the appearance ofshape coexisting phenomena or of shape mixing through the use ofselective experiments (e.g. band structure, spectroscopic factors,static moments, E0 properties and alpha-decay)
